Bug 805922 - during repo clone or local syncs, pulp ignores any additional files part of treeinfo
Summary: during repo clone or local syncs, pulp ignores any additional files part of t...
Keywords:
Status: CLOSED CURRENTRELEASE
Alias: None
Product: Pulp
Classification: Retired
Component: user-experience
Version: 1.1.0
Hardware: Unspecified
OS: Unspecified
unspecified
unspecified
Target Milestone: ---
: ---
Assignee: Pradeep Kilambi
QA Contact: Preethi Thomas
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2012-03-22 13:08 UTC by Pradeep Kilambi
Modified: 2013-09-09 16:33 UTC (History)
1 user (show)

Fixed In Version:
Clone Of:
Environment:
Last Closed: 2012-05-25 14:13:08 UTC
Embargoed:


Attachments (Terms of Use)

Description Pradeep Kilambi 2012-03-22 13:08:27 UTC
Description of problem:

We only account for images directory during clone and local sync process. But there could be other files such as Server/repodata that needs to be accounted for in RHEL-5 case.

Comment 1 Pradeep Kilambi 2012-03-22 18:54:13 UTC
commit 193942db69afb15830ed64be28ede47aa0afd1f2
Author: Pradeep Kilambi <pkilambi>
Date:   Thu Mar 22 14:52:13 2012 -0400

    805922 - adding sync logic to look for server directory during clone/local syncs

Comment 2 Jeff Ortel 2012-03-26 16:00:51 UTC
build: 1.0.0-7

Comment 3 Preethi Thomas 2012-03-27 00:57:59 UTC
verified

[root@qe-blade-15 ~]# rpm -q pulp
pulp-1.0.0-8
[root@qe-blade-15 ~]# 

Rhel5 repo from CDN

[root@qe-blade-15 ~]# ls -l /var/lib/pulp/repos/content/dist/rhel/rhui/server/5/5.8/x86_64/os/Server/repodata/
total 80
lrwxrwxrwx 1 apache apache 158 Mar 26 13:38 41edf16632c20fa5d78fabb196c4aa0189a60eec-other.sqlite.bz2 -> ../../../../../../../../../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/41edf16632c20fa5d78fabb196c4aa0189a60eec-other.sqlite.bz2
lrwxrwxrwx 1 apache apache 169 Mar 26 13:38 61de24a90a8f9fc4b7815289cbbb830ccc93830f-comps-rhel5-server-core.xml -> ../../../../../../../../../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/61de24a90a8f9fc4b7815289cbbb830ccc93830f-comps-rhel5-server-core.xml
lrwxrwxrwx 1 apache apache 154 Mar 26 13:38 6a0bdcb6d83fe2bc9d7e73a36ef8db117ffd91a6-other.xml.gz -> ../../../../../../../../../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/6a0bdcb6d83fe2bc9d7e73a36ef8db117ffd91a6-other.xml.gz
lrwxrwxrwx 1 apache apache 160 Mar 26 13:38 8645da9ba2470eb0aab996fa3d444ca1a4a0b0f6-primary.sqlite.bz2 -> ../../../../../../../../../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/8645da9ba2470eb0aab996fa3d444ca1a4a0b0f6-primary.sqlite.bz2
lrwxrwxrwx 1 apache apache 158 Mar 26 13:38 8d10d276fc380eec64ad04746c1513ef29fe2148-filelists.xml.gz -> ../../../../../../../../../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/8d10d276fc380eec64ad04746c1513ef29fe2148-filelists.xml.gz
lrwxrwxrwx 1 apache apache 162 Mar 26 13:38 a87263a52c57a014182832c26cbb966983442504-filelists.sqlite.bz2 -> ../../../../../../../../../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/a87263a52c57a014182832c26cbb966983442504-filelists.sqlite.bz2
lrwxrwxrwx 1 apache apache 172 Mar 26 13:38 a8becaff89f5026f4445156fe4522384e0944afd-comps-rhel5-server-core.xml.gz -> ../../../../../../../../../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/a8becaff89f5026f4445156fe4522384e0944afd-comps-rhel5-server-core.xml.gz
lrwxrwxrwx 1 apache apache 156 Mar 26 13:38 d7c5db98d5d2e1ecdaf5daf93eaf9ad9ed4b8155-primary.xml.gz -> ../../../../../../../../../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/d7c5db98d5d2e1ecdaf5daf93eaf9ad9ed4b8155-primary.xml.gz
lrwxrwxrwx 1 apache apache 113 Mar 26 13:38 productid.gz -> ../../../../../../../../../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/productid.gz
lrwxrwxrwx 1 apache apache 111 Mar 26 13:38 repomd.xml -> ../../../../../../../../../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/repomd.xml


After clone

[root@qe-blade-15 ~]# ls -l /var/lib/pulp/repos/rhel5-clone/
drpms/    images/   Packages/ repodata/ Server/   treeinfo  
[root@qe-blade-15 ~]# ls -l /var/lib/pulp/repos/rhel5-clone/Server/repodata/
total 80
lrwxrwxrwx 1 apache apache 134 Mar 26 17:04 41edf16632c20fa5d78fabb196c4aa0189a60eec-other.sqlite.bz2 -> ../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/41edf16632c20fa5d78fabb196c4aa0189a60eec-other.sqlite.bz2
lrwxrwxrwx 1 apache apache 145 Mar 26 17:04 61de24a90a8f9fc4b7815289cbbb830ccc93830f-comps-rhel5-server-core.xml -> ../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/61de24a90a8f9fc4b7815289cbbb830ccc93830f-comps-rhel5-server-core.xml
lrwxrwxrwx 1 apache apache 130 Mar 26 17:04 6a0bdcb6d83fe2bc9d7e73a36ef8db117ffd91a6-other.xml.gz -> ../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/6a0bdcb6d83fe2bc9d7e73a36ef8db117ffd91a6-other.xml.gz
lrwxrwxrwx 1 apache apache 136 Mar 26 17:04 8645da9ba2470eb0aab996fa3d444ca1a4a0b0f6-primary.sqlite.bz2 -> ../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/8645da9ba2470eb0aab996fa3d444ca1a4a0b0f6-primary.sqlite.bz2
lrwxrwxrwx 1 apache apache 134 Mar 26 17:04 8d10d276fc380eec64ad04746c1513ef29fe2148-filelists.xml.gz -> ../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/8d10d276fc380eec64ad04746c1513ef29fe2148-filelists.xml.gz
lrwxrwxrwx 1 apache apache 138 Mar 26 17:04 a87263a52c57a014182832c26cbb966983442504-filelists.sqlite.bz2 -> ../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/a87263a52c57a014182832c26cbb966983442504-filelists.sqlite.bz2
lrwxrwxrwx 1 apache apache 148 Mar 26 17:04 a8becaff89f5026f4445156fe4522384e0944afd-comps-rhel5-server-core.xml.gz -> ../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/a8becaff89f5026f4445156fe4522384e0944afd-comps-rhel5-server-core.xml.gz
lrwxrwxrwx 1 apache apache 132 Mar 26 17:04 d7c5db98d5d2e1ecdaf5daf93eaf9ad9ed4b8155-primary.xml.gz -> ../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/d7c5db98d5d2e1ecdaf5daf93eaf9ad9ed4b8155-primary.xml.gz
lrwxrwxrwx 1 apache apache  89 Mar 26 17:04 productid.gz -> ../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/productid.gz
lrwxrwxrwx 1 apache apache  87 Mar 26 17:04 repomd.xml -> ../../../../distributions/ks-Red Hat Enterprise Linux Server-None-5.8-x86_64/repomd.xml
[root@qe-blade-15 ~]#

Comment 4 Preethi Thomas 2012-05-25 14:13:08 UTC
Pulp v1.1 Release


Note You need to log in before you can comment on or make changes to this bug.